We are seeking a Key Account Manager (KAM) based in UB Head Office:

JOB PURPOSE:

The Key Account Manager (KAM) is responsible for achieving sustainable financial and market share growth of the designated key customer account through overall coordination of the local business and engagement with global account related customer stakeholders with respect to key decision makers affecting the local customer account. The role needs to be the expert on all customer affairs and business requirements combined with a strong understanding of Sandvik’s product & service offering, which are critical to identifying business opportunities, developing a winning strategy and situation-specific action plans to achieve sustainable growth for the overall Sandvik Mining offering.

MAIN RESPONSIBILITES:

  • Determine Sandvik’s position with the customer (e.g., demographics and product portfolio white spots/market share surveys and detailed stakeholder mapping)
  • Identify business opportunities for entire Sandvik Mining offering such as Rock Tools, Parts & Service, Load & Haul, Ground Support, Underground Drilling, Surface Drilling, Digital Mining Technologies and Mechanical Cutting incl. growth of aftermarket solutions and capital equipment forecasting
  • Develop account vision, strategic objectives, collaboration roadmap, opportunity mapping, focus areas/success factors, and all action plans – supporting the customer in becoming successful in meeting their goals/strategy while maintaining a strong focus on internal objectives
  • Set commercial and operational directions for local team members and strong involvement in site-level planning (division by division)
  • Proactively share/develop business plans with each of the relevant Division’s representatives to achieve alignment, buy-in and create a collaborative working environment (business line representatives/managers)
  • Be responsible for monitoring and the implementation of set plans through close collaboration and follow up with relevant internal stakeholders
  • Forecast and achieve revenue budgets and sales targets in alignment with respective business lines/divisions
  • Conduct regular Sandvik NPS survey to assess customer experience with Sandvik offering and follow-up improvement action plans to continuously improve customer satisfaction
  • Responsible for calculations of budgetary and investments providing the company & the responsible account with all necessary details
  • Required to develop and maintain strong stakeholder understanding through constant mapping for all internal and external stakeholders (Local Organization, Local Department Managers, Regional Management Team, Business Line Representatives and Executive Management)
  • Coordinate and rally internal initiatives and support when required
  • Utilize established relationships to support the business & customer
  • Manage projects and collaborations to enhance long-term customer relationships at all levels

Your profile

  • Bachelor’s degree in finance, engineering, Mining, Business management or Marketing, or similar related degree.
  • Fluent in English Language and excellent communication in English and Mongolian
  • Formal qualifications or experience in mining, heavy machinery or equivalent discipline combined with previous successful achievement in sales activities or equivalent knowledge and skills gained through practical work experience
  • Presentation development and execution to a high standard
  • Excel usage for data analysis and business case development
  • Leadership of a team (Particularly leading without authority) and able to build relationships with different kinds of stakeholders
  • Discuss Macro and Micro Economic impacts to business with stakeholders
  • Able to work/visit and conduct business meetings and training in OTUG mine site environment
